Photo by Emma J. Logue

St. Thomas Hotel Guide - Magens Bay hotels in St. Thomas, U.S. Virgin Islands.
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check prices for these dates
Our top choices for Magens Bay hotels

The Hideaway Hull Bay
The Hideaway Hull Bay2.1 km from Magens Bay
9.6 out of 10, Exceptional, (54 reviews)
The price is €648
includes taxes & fees
27 Jan - 28 Jan

Villa Indigo 1BR in Private Gated Estate
Villa Indigo 1BR in Private Gated Estate2.7 km from Magens Bay
9.0 out of 10, Wonderful, (27 reviews)
The price is €314
includes taxes & fees
15 Jan - 16 Jan

The Cottage at Villa Indigo
The Cottage at Villa Indigo3.1 km from Magens Bay
8.8 out of 10, Excellent, (15 reviews)
The price is €380
includes taxes & fees
15 Jan - 16 Jan

Flamboyan on the Bay Resort and Villas
Flamboyan on the Bay Resort and Villas2.4 km from Magens Bay
8.6 out of 10, Excellent, (814 reviews)
The price is €150
includes taxes & fees
19 Jan - 20 Jan

Mafolie Hotel
Mafolie Hotel2.9 km from Magens Bay
8.6 out of 10, Excellent, (1,003 reviews)
The price is €161
includes taxes & fees
20 Jan - 21 Jan

Little Indigo Apartments
Little Indigo Apartments3.1 km from Magens Bay
8.4 out of 10, Very good, (23 reviews)
The price is €288
includes taxes & fees
19 Jan - 20 Jan

The Mary Anne Boutique Hotel USVI
The Mary Anne Boutique Hotel USVI3.4 km from Magens Bay
10.0 out of 10, Exceptional, (15 reviews)
The price is €382
includes taxes & fees
15 Jan - 16 Jan

Hotel 1829
Hotel 18293.5 km from Magens Bay
9.8 out of 10, Exceptional, (9 reviews)
The price is €351
includes taxes & fees
2 Feb - 3 Feb

Olga's Fancy
Olga's Fancy4.4 km from Magens Bay
9.6 out of 10, Exceptional, (1,000 reviews)
The price is €146
includes taxes & fees
19 Jan - 20 Jan

Island View Guesthouse
Island View Guesthouse3.9 km from Magens Bay
9.4 out of 10, Exceptional, (289 reviews)

Hampton by Hilton St. Thomas
Hampton by Hilton St. ThomasHavensight, 4.7 km from Magens Bay
9.2 out of 10, Wonderful, (60 reviews)
The price is €352
includes taxes & fees
30 Jan - 31 Jan

The Pink Palm Hotel - Adults Only
The Pink Palm Hotel - Adults Only3.5 km from Magens Bay
9.0 out of 10, Wonderful, (355 reviews)

Marriott's Frenchman's Cove
Marriott's Frenchman's Cove5.8 km from Magens Bay
9.0 out of 10, Wonderful, (190 reviews)
The price is €983
includes taxes & fees
15 Jan - 16 Jan

Bluebeard's Castle Resort
Bluebeard's Castle Resort3.9 km from Magens Bay
8.6 out of 10, Excellent, (22 reviews)
The price is €269
includes taxes & fees
18 Jan - 19 Jan

The Landmark Apartment
The Landmark Apartment5.7 km from Magens Bay
8.8 out of 10, Excellent, (15 reviews)
The price is €354
includes taxes & fees
16 Jan - 17 Jan


Secret Harbour Beach Resort
Secret Harbour Beach Resort10.5 km from Magens Bay
9.0 out of 10, Wonderful, (1,009 reviews)
The price is €527
includes taxes & fees
28 Jan - 29 Jan

The Westin St. Thomas Beach Resort & Spa
The Westin St. Thomas Beach Resort & Spa6.1 km from Magens Bay
8.4 out of 10, Very good, (1,036 reviews)
The price is €779
includes taxes & fees
24 Jan - 25 Jan


Two Sandals – A Boutique Hotel
Two Sandals – A Boutique Hotel10.5 km from Magens Bay
8.8 out of 10, Excellent, (473 reviews)
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top Magens Bay Hotel Reviews

Casa Jo Mama so private clothing is optional!!
10/10 Excellent


































































